Mysterious Type 216X appears on engineering documents, future Isometric replacement?

While work on the Advanced Rome 216A continues, a new ship type has appeared on various DF Engineering documents and lists. This is the Type 216X which has appeared on the list of pending worm drive geometries to be created to allow the ship to safely make a worm jump. According to the details of the geometry it will be similar to the Advanced Rome but longer and have a mission wing like the Repulse 51B.

The second place Type 216X has appeared is on a list of n-Core engines being developed. A second generation engine with around 20% more thrust than the Tachyon PM-01A to be fitted to Advanced Rome is being developed. Analysts say the details of the Type 216X seem to match the planned Isometric family replacement planned for the second half of the 2130s.

The ship, when completed, will probably not be known as Type 216X as UNDF often use designations like this as placeholders. Indeed, it has been rumoured that the Isometric replacement could be the Type 220. As yet we are a long way off. DF's priority is to get Advanced Rome into service by 2130.
